A Deep Dive into Cape Town's Gay Bars and Clubs
While the city's gay bar scene has experienced some shifts in recent years, several venues remain popular destinations. Many frequented spots are clustered in the De Waterkant area of Green Point, offering a mix of trendy bars and lively clubs. The loss of some beloved establishments like Crew Bar, however, is a reminder of the evolving nature of the nightlife scene.
Iconic and Popular Venues
- The Pink Candy: This popular club offers ample space for dancing and socializing, with a welcoming atmosphere and reasonable drink prices. Themed events and diverse DJs create a dynamic experience. It's known for its spacious floor plan and friendly staff.
- Stargayzers: Known for its chic atmosphere and expensive drinks, Stargayzers attracts discerning patrons. Expect a sophisticated ambiance, a wide range of music, and a dress code that leans towards smart casual attire.
- Zero21: Offering a blend of locals and tourists, Zero21 is known for its lively atmosphere, themed events, and karaoke nights. This is a great choice for a fun and energetic night out.
- Café Manhattan: A classic and well-regarded option for meeting people and enjoying food and drinks in a relaxed setting. Perfect for a pre-club or casual get-together.

Celebrating Pride in Cape Town
October marks South Africa's Pride Month, with a plethora of events throughout the city. The Cape Town Pride Parade is a highlight, featuring dancers, floats, and performers. Rocking the Daisies is another popular event that attracts queer individuals, resembling a smaller Coachella-style experience in South Africa.
